Stop 1: Blue Lagoon — Crystal Waters and Serenity

Split/Trogir: Half-Day(5 hours) 3-Island Speedboat Adventure - Stop 1: Blue Lagoon — Crystal Waters and Serenity

After a 15-20 minute ride from Trogir (or about 35-40 from Split), your first destination is the Blue Lagoon on Veliki Drvenik. This spot is renowned for its crystal-clear turquoise waters and tranquil vibe. Many reviews mention the high quality of the swimming and snorkeling here — some say they saw lots of fish and enjoyed exploring the underwater world with the provided gear.

Guests often remark on the peacefulness of the lagoon, which feels like a hidden paradise. It’s the perfect place to relax on the boat, sip an ice-cold drink, or soak up the sun while floating in the calm sea. Expect around 1.5 hours at this stop, which feels just right — enough to swim, take photos, and unwind without feeling rushed.

The serenity of Blue Lagoon is frequently highlighted as a tour highlight. One reviewer even shared that the staff were friendly and attentive, adding to the overall relaxed atmosphere. It’s a scenic, refreshing start that sets the tone for the rest of the day.

Stop 2: Maslinica — A Charming Village with a Twist

Split/Trogir: Half-Day(5 hours) 3-Island Speedboat Adventure - Stop 2: Maslinica — A Charming Village with a Twist

Next, a 15-20 minute ride takes you to Maslinica on Olta, a tiny village with a big personality. Here, you’ll find a restored 16th-century castle that’s now a luxury hotel, perched on the waterfront, along with traditional stone houses. It’s a great spot for a leisurely stroll, taking photos, or simply soaking up the relaxed yet historic ambiance.

Many reviews praise the authentic feel of Maslinica, with some mentioning the lovely waterfront and picturesque views. This stop isn’t just about scenery — it offers a glimpse into local life and history, making it a nice balance between the natural beauty of the sea and cultural interest. You’ll typically have about an hour here, which is enough to explore, take photos, or grab a quick snack.

A handful of travelers have commented that guides provided interesting background during the visit, enhancing the experience. For example, one review describes the visit as “wonderful to plunge in (with some interesting historical, cultural background).” It’s a peaceful, scenic break that adds variety to the trip.

Stop 3: Duga Cove — A Hidden Beach Paradise

Split/Trogir: Half-Day(5 hours) 3-Island Speedboat Adventure - Stop 3: Duga Cove — A Hidden Beach Paradise

The final stop is at Duga Cove on Iovo, reached after a 25-30 minute ride. This spot is renowned for its natural sandy seabed and tranquil environment — perfect for those seeking a peaceful swim or snorkel away from crowds. Many reviewers note that the water here is just as clear as at Blue Lagoon, with some calling it a “hidden gem.”

You’ll have about an hour to enjoy the calm waters, with options to snorkel, sunbathe, or just listen to the waves. The beach bar Borkko nearby adds a casual vibe, with good drinks and a relaxed setting. Some travelers mention that it’s their favorite part of the trip, appreciating the secluded feel and natural beauty.

The reviews reflect that guides often facilitate easy access and make sure everyone gets a chance to relax and enjoy. If you’re looking for a less crowded, more authentic beach experience, this stop hits the mark.
